>> > Since the force restore logic will restore the CRTCs state one at a
>> > time, it is possible that the state will be inconsistent until the whole
>> > operation finishes. A call to intel_modeset_check_state() is done once
>> > it's over, so don't check the state multiple times in between. This
>> > regression was introduced in:
